GEN III HEMI VVT Harness
2009+ Gen III Hemi engines rolled off the showroom floor with Variable Valve Timing (VVT). Now, both Terminator X and Terminator X Max ECUs will allow you to control and tune the VVT with the use of the plug and play VVT harness.
GEN III HEMI VVT and SRV Harness
If you are using a stock intake manifold that came from the factory with the Short Runner Valve, we also have a new plug and play sub harness that will allow you to utilize the SRV actuator and capitalize on its low RPM torque benefits.
Chrysler 46RE Transmission Control Harness
If your HEMI swap project is using a Chrysler 46RE Transmission, commonly found in 1996-2003 Dodge Ram – Dakota, or Durango V8 trucks, you can finally control your transmission through the Terminator X or X MAX ECU.
Keep in mind, the 46RE has a mechanically controlled 1-2 and 2-3 shift, meaning you must run a TV cable to ensure no damage is done to the transmission. The Terminator X will allow you to control your 3-4 shift, Lockup Torque Converter, and the electronically controlled governor pressure circuit, within the transmission.
